these are the clips that hold the stainless trim on top of the door up against the glass on a 72 scamp.
The clips have some kind of material in it to keep the water out.the newer ones(pictured on right) are from r/t specialties and don't have it nor do they fit properly.they are a slightly different shape.

anyone know where to get these like the ones on the left?
I have also tried mr. g's and can't find them.

I got all excited and west you're right they are different. I know if they are not exact the trim will sit either too close to the glass or too far to the outside and on top of that the trim will be loose. See the way the top of the clip is more heart shaped than the other clips, that's the part that positions it on the narrow top edge of the door and quarter (glass) area. They are hard to find even used for some reason
